    I wasn't talking about the "word" Oracle, I was talking about everything "in" Oracle, everything with a name, every person's name, every creature and planet they named, etc, They may have a lot of made up names but others are "taken", and just because they can't pronounce some germanic name and fansubs decide to keep it that way, doesn't mean the original name should not be used in an proper localisation.

    Quote Originally Posted by Kondibon View Post
    They're not doing it for the sake of doing it though, they're doing it to be more consistant, while making the main term sound better when spoken in english.

    Naberius is spelled wrong but it's kind of an obscure reference to a goetic demon anyway, so I don't blame anyone for getting it wrong. Granted, they very clearly say naBerius, but eh.
    Maybe that's because Japanese does not distinguish between V and B phonetics. A lot of languages that use both letters don't distinguish them either, spanish being one of my languages, I know that SOME regions in Spain pronounce V with an F friction, but the language rules don't distinguish them, other than changing the meaning of the word if you use one or the other (ex: vaca/baca). The same could be said of Motabia / Motavia, even if at that time we didn't know the pronunciation, the japanese name would be with a BI because they don't have any other choice.
